Commission awards FY2026 annual bids; Geo-Stabilization International bid corrected in record
Summary
The commission approved the recommended bidders for Jackson County’s fiscal year 2026 annual bids. County staff noted one bidder, Geo-Stabilization International, submitted an erroneous excavation line item and an omission for mobilization that staff corrected for the record but said their recommendation stands.

Jackson County commissioners on Oct. 22 voted to approve the county’s recommended award list for fiscal year 2026 bids.
Staff noted the bids were opened Aug. 11 and that the recommended awards were included in the meeting packet. During discussion, county staff highlighted one vendor — Geo-Stabilization International — as the lone bidder on a geohazard mitigation and emergency-response advertisement. The staff representative said the company’s bid contained an error for the excavation unit price (originally listed at $1.60 per cubic yard in the advertised bid) that the vendor corrected to $37.50 per cubic yard, and the bid omitted mobilization/demobilization for excavation and grading in some line items. After accounting for the corrected excavation price and adding mobilization/demobilization, staff said the county’s estimate still projects a potential overall cost reduction and that the recommendation to award to that vendor did not change.
The commission moved and seconded approval of the recommended bidders and approved the awards by voice vote.
County staff did not read every vendor name or contract amount during the meeting; the packet that accompanies the minutes contains the full recommended award list and line-item details.
